Rusty Nail Milk Punch

What happens when you take the smoky, honey-sweet Rusty Nail cocktail and introduce it to dairy, heat, and spice? Your new favorite eggnog alternative, that's what.

Recipe information

  • Yield

    <p>Makes about 4 cups, serving 4 to 6.</p>

Ingredients

3 tablespoons honey, or to taste
3 cups milk
1/2 teaspoon ground ginger
1/2 teaspoon freshly grated nutmeg plus additional for garnish
1/2 cup Scotch, or to taste
1/4 cup Drambuie, or to taste

Preparation

  1. In a saucepan stir together the honey, the milk, the ginger and 1/2 teaspoon of the nutmeg and heat the mixture over moderately low heat, stirring, until it is hot. Stir in the Scotch and the Drambuie, divide the milk punch among heated mugs, and sprinkle each drink with some of the additional nutmeg.
